The quality of a seed is defined by many parameters such as its genotype, the environment in which it developed, its level of maturity when it is harvested, but also post-harvest treatment. The environment includes climate, sylviculture, number of reproducers, harvest year, etc. This quality is generally determining for the longevity of the seed and its germination capacity. However, for beech, like many forest species, we do not know the impact of the environment on this quality, nor the determinism of genetic variability in its capacity to adapt to future climatic conditions. We cannot therefore explain, with the little current knowledge, the phenomena of seedling dieback observed in recent years in marginal beech forests.
